This year, the 35,200 mu of peppers planted by farmers in Kuqa City, Xinjiang, have been harvested, and the villagers have done a good job of harvesting when they grab the farmers. It is understood that this year, the planting area of pepper in Kuqa City reached 35,200 mu, and it is expected to produce 600 kg per mu, with an average income of 5,200 yuan per mu, an average increase of 550 yuan per mu compared with the same period last year.

Pictured: Farmers in Dunkuotan Town, Kuqa City, harvest peppers with a large pepper harvester on October 12.
